Loveneesh Rana received his PhD degree in aerospace engineering from the University of Texas at Arlington (UTA), in 2017. He has over 7 years of experience in the advanced research facility, the Aerospace Vehicle Design (AVD) Lab at the UTA where he worked on developing state-of-the-art design synthesis solutions. His main area of expertise lies in the development of systems-level synthesis solutions for the ideation of future generation of space systems. Loveneesh joined the Remote Sensing Applications group, RSA, headed by Prof. Tonie Van Dam.
